4. One Senseless Goldberg Segment

One day after losing a fine Hell in a Cell match to Roman Reigns on pay-per-view, Rusev was speared out of his boots by Goldberg in a nonsensical, unnecessary segment on Raw.

Yes, WWE had to show that the old Goldberg was back, but did they really need to make Rusev look like a jobber at the same time or have Goldberg laugh in his face when provoked? The answer is no, no they didn't, and Paul Heyman's feigned pity only made him look foolish too; a smart and crafty general like Heyman would get himself to safety before worrying about anybody else, especially if Goldberg was still in the ring.

The message was loud and clear: full-time regulars like Rusev were less important than ageing part-timers WWE wanted to heat up quickly. Even long time WCW fans, whether they were happy to see Bill back on television again or not, must have realised that WWE's decision to senselessly feed a major part of their latest pay-per-view to the wolves sucked.

Things would get worse from there.
